How Does the UPS 12360 6F2 Ensure Power Continuity?

The UPS 12360 6F2 uses double-conversion online topology to deliver clean, stable power by converting AC to DC and back to AC. This eliminates voltage fluctuations and filters electrical noise, protecting sensitive equipment. Its lithium-ion battery technology provides faster charging and longer lifespan compared to traditional lead-acid batteries, ensuring consistent performance during prolonged outages.

The system’s adaptive voltage regulation automatically adjusts to input voltage variations within ±25% without switching to battery power. This feature is particularly valuable in regions with unstable grid infrastructure. For mission-critical operations, the UPS 12360 6F2 offers seamless transition times of less than 2 milliseconds, ensuring sensitive digital equipment like network switches and PLC controllers remain operational during grid failures. Advanced thermal management using liquid cooling maintains optimal battery temperature, extending cell life even in high-utilization scenarios.

Why Choose Lithium-Ion Technology in the UPS 12360 6F2?

Lithium-ion batteries in the UPS 12360 6F2 offer 50% less weight, 3x faster charging, and 2x longer cycle life than lead-acid alternatives. They operate efficiently in extreme temperatures (-20°C to 60°C) and require zero maintenance. This reduces total cost of ownership and ensures reliable performance in harsh industrial environments.

Can the UPS 12360 6F2 Integrate with Renewable Energy Systems?

Yes, it supports hybrid configurations with solar/wind inputs through its adaptive charging algorithm. The system prioritizes renewable sources while maintaining grid synchronization, reducing energy costs by up to 40%. Its bi-directional inverter enables vehicle-to-grid (V2G) compatibility for electric forklifts or fleet charging stations.

How long does the UPS 12360 6F2 battery last during an outage?
At full load (12kVA), runtime is 15-30 minutes. With optional extended battery cabinets, runtime scales linearly up to 8 hours. Eco-mode extends this by 20% through optimized inverter efficiency.
Is the UPS 12360 6F2 compliant with international safety standards?
Yes. It meets UL 1778, IEC 62040-3, and ISO 8528-5 for performance, plus UN38.3 for lithium battery transport. Certifications include CE, RoHS, and NEBS Level 3 for telecommunications.
What warranty comes with the UPS 12360 6F2?
A 3-year comprehensive warranty covers parts, labor, and battery replacement. Optional 5/7-year plans include on-site technical support and annual preventive maintenance checks.
